Read MoreThe Smart Way to Store Your Boat: Why Shrink Wrapping Is Worth It
As boating season starts to wind down, now is the time to protect your investment. Shrink wrapping offers a secure barrier against snow, ice, UV rays and moisture. This protective seal helps prevent mold, fading and costly Spring repairs.

Understanding Diminished Value: The Hidden Cost of a Collision
Even after professional repairs, your vehicle may still lose value. That loss is known as diminished value, and it can impact your resale or trade-in potential. Many buyers and dealers are wary of vehicles with accident histories, even if the repairs are flawless.
